General annotation (Comments)
| Function | Converts lysophosphatidic acid (LPA) into phosphatidic acid by incorporating acyl moiety at the 2 position By similarity. |
| Catalytic activity | Acyl-CoA + 1-acyl-sn-glycerol 3-phosphate = CoA + 1,2-diacyl-sn-glycerol 3-phosphate. |
| Pathway | |
| Subcellular location | Cell inner membrane; Peripheral membrane protein By similarity. |
| Domain | The HXXXXD motif is essential for acyltransferase activity and may constitute the binding site for the phosphate moiety of the glycerol-3-phosphate By similarity. |
| Sequence similarities | Belongs to the 1-acyl-sn-glycerol-3-phosphate acyltransferase family. |
